從 Java TreeSet 獲取 Head Set
要獲取 Head Set,你需要使用 headset() 方法。這使使用者能夠按排序順序獲取一組元素。
首先,設定 TreeSet 並新增元素
TreeSet<String> tSet = new TreeSet<String>(); tSet.add("P"); tSet.add("Q"); tSet.add("R"); tSet.add("S");
現在讓我們獲取 Head Set
SortedSet s = tSet.headSet("S");
以下是從 Java 中的 TreeSet 獲取 Head Set 的示例
示例
import java.util.*; public class Demo { public static void main(String args[]){ TreeSet<String> tSet = new TreeSet<String>(); tSet.add("P"); tSet.add("Q"); tSet.add("R"); tSet.add("S"); System.out.println("TreeSet elements..."); Iterator i = tSet.iterator(); while(i.hasNext()){ System.out.println(i.next()); } SortedSet s = tSet.headSet("S"); System.out.println("Head Set has = " + s); } }
輸出
輸出如下
TreeSet elements... P Q R S Head Set has = [P, Q, R]
廣告